Super Mario Brothers: Amada Anime Series (1989)
Synopsis
Amada Anime Series: Super Mario Bros. is a series of three direct-to-video OVAs produced by Studio Junio, licensed by Nintendo, and released on VHS tapes on August 3, 1989, exclusively in Japan. The plot of the episodes involve characters from the Mario franchise in the stories of three fairy tales: Momotarō, Issun-bōshi and Snow White.

Episodes:
-
Ep. 1: Super Mario Momotarō
On a tiny star, two elderly Hammer Bros. are grandparents to a beautiful girl, Princess Peach. However, she is so beautiful, that the evil demon king Bowser decides to kidnap her and make her his wife. Mario, after hearing the story, decides to set off to free Peach from the demon king's claws.
-
Ep. 2: Super Mario Issun-bōshi
A shooting star gives a couple the child they had wished for, Mario, but he is only an inch tall. As the child grows older, he becomes adventurous and eventually sets his sights on a distant city, convincing his Mama and Papa to let him journey there on his own.
-
Ep. 3: Super Mario Shirayuki-hime
The seven Mushroom Retainers play the seven dwarves, Mario plays the prince, Princess Peach plays Snow White, Bowser plays the evil queen, and Luigi plays the prince's brother in this retelling of Snow White, Mario style.
